Output f8cc933d21561a68da06b3480412364a88fa755148cd01e14cd47d0fba61c6e9:16

value
110112434259
script pubkey
OP_0 OP_PUSHBYTES_20 e325162be2f2ad19b7cb18f58e9688d1c82958f2
address
tb1quvj3v2lz72k3nd7trr6ca95g68yzjk8jrmmr76
transaction
f8cc933d21561a68da06b3480412364a88fa755148cd01e14cd47d0fba61c6e9
confirmations
15809
spent
true